Tom Yum Chicken Noodles

Tom Yum Chicken Coconut Curry is a vibrant and flavourful Thai-inspired dish that combines the comforting richness of coconut milk with the bold, spicy, and tangy notes of Tom Yum paste. Perfect for a cozy dinner or a special occasion, this curry is best enjoyed with a side of rice or noodles.

Ingredients:

  • 1 kg chicken breast, diced into small cubes
  • 2 tbsp paprika powder
  • 1 tbsp Kashmiri chili powder
  • 2 tbsp ginger paste
  • 1 tsp mild chili powder
  • 1 tbsp danya jeera (coriander-cumin) powder
  • 2 tsp salt
  • 1/2 tsp MSG (optional)
  • 1 tsp turmeric powder
  • 1 tsp black pepper powder
  • 3 tbsp garlic paste
  • 1/4 cup oil
  • 2 onions, chopped
  • 1 1/2 cups coconut milk
  • 1/2 cup water (optional, for thinner curry)
  • 2 tbsp Tom Yum paste
  • Fresh coriander leaves, for garnish
  • Cooked rice or noodles, for serving
  • Chili oil and crispy filo pastry (optional, for garnish)

Instructions:

  1. Marinate the Chicken:
    • In a bowl, combine paprika powder, Kashmiri chili powder, ginger paste, mild chili powder, danya jeera powder, salt, MSG (if using), turmeric powder, black pepper powder, and garlic paste.
    • Mix well to form a marinade paste.
    • Add diced chicken breast to the marinade and coat the pieces evenly.
    • Let the chicken marinate for at least 20 minutes to allow the flavours to infuse.
  2. Cook the Curry:
    • Heat oil in a wok or large pan over medium heat.
    • Add chopped onions to the heated oil and sauté until they turn translucent.
    • Add marinated chicken cubes to the pan along with the onions.
    • Increase the heat to high and fry the chicken cubes with the onions for about 6 minutes, or until they develop a golden sear.
  3. Add Coconut Milk and Tom Yum Paste:
    • Once the chicken and onions are cooked, reduce the heat to medium-low.
    • Pour in the coconut milk and stir gently to combine with the chicken.
    • If you prefer a thinner curry, add water at this stage and mix well.
    • Add Tom Yum paste to the curry mixture and stir until evenly distributed.
    • Bring the mixture to a gentle boil, then cover the pan with a lid.
  4. Simmer and Serve:
    • Let the curry simmer for about 15 minutes, allowing the flavours to meld together.
    • Once the curry is cooked and fragrant, remove it from the heat.
    • Garnish the Tom Yum Chicken Coconut Curry with fresh coriander leaves.
    • Serve hot with cooked rice or noodles.
    • Optionally, garnish with a drizzle of chili oil and crispy filo pastry for added texture and flavour.

Tips:

  • Marinating Time: Allow the chicken to marinate for longer (up to overnight) for deeper flavour.
  • Spice Level: Adjust the amount of chili powder to suit your heat preference.
  • Consistency: Add more or less water depending on how thick you like your curry.
  • Serving Suggestion: Pair with a simple cucumber salad or a cooling raita to balance the spice.
